George Arthur Hardinge ( – ) was an officer in the Royal Navy.

Life & Career

He was appointed in command of the second class protected cruiser Æolus on 4 July, 1905.[1]

Hardinge was appointed in command of the battleship Ramillies in 1907.[2]

He was appointed in command of the armoured cruiser Donegal on 1 February, 1908.[3]
